Unlike #2 (next one), I got this one right. You mentioned that this is a blitzing theme rather than a building one. I think this is largely true because you create a 2pt board, and put 2 on the roof. Almost any time that you put two up, its a blitzing theme, or buying time at least.

I would have made the 3pt here after entering, mostly because its an extra point, it unloads the heavy 8, and I know that 2 checkers are going up. Any extra partial dance is going to be near fatal for my opponent.

Are there any other features of the position here that might be a factor? Well, the score is certainly one of them. Perhaps you should be thinking about increasing volatility, creating more stretched positions, getting to blitz type cubes rather than positional cubes. I mean, you'd rather be sending a cube over while your opponent has 1 on the bar getting blitzed than sending over a 12-15% race lead holding game cube.
